Hilton has announced the signing of two Tapestry Collection by Hilton hotels in Plymouth and Cork, expanding its portfolio in the UK and Ireland.
Hilton has signed agreements for two new Tapestry Collection by Hilton hotels, one in Plymouth, England, and one in Cork, Ireland. The announcement marks the brand’s entry into both cities and is part of Hilton’s expansion of its lifestyle portfolio across the UK and Ireland. The two properties are expected to create approximately 100 jobs.
The New Continental Plymouth, Tapestry Collection by Hilton, will be located in Plymouth city centre on Millbay Road. The hotel, originally built in 1865, will join the Tapestry Collection under a franchise agreement with Elevate Hotels Plymouth Ltd. The property will feature 120 fully renovated guest rooms, meeting facilities, a fitness centre, and a restaurant and bar. The opening is scheduled for spring 2027.
The Cork City Centre, Tapestry Collection by Hilton, will be a new-build property located on South Terrace in Cork City. The hotel will include 103 guest rooms, with a mix of standard rooms and extended-stay accommodation featuring kitchenettes. Facilities will include a restaurant and breakfast area, a bar, and a fitness space. The hotel is expected to open in autumn 2027 in partnership with JMK Group.
The two new signings bring the number of Tapestry Collection properties in regional locations to six, joining existing hotels in Dover, York, Portrush, and St Albans. The announcement follows previous additions to Hilton’s lifestyle brands in the region, including the signing of Motto by Hilton in Manchester, Tempo by Hilton in Belfast, and two Curio Collection by Hilton hotels in London.
